Recommendations: R-01: Disagree The timeline and the oversight are more than adequate and include annual visits; annual programmatic reports; monthly attendance of VCOE oversight staff at charter school board meetings; 2/year director meetings; regular correspondence R-02: Has been implemented. R-03: Disagree VCOE conducts regular meetings for all charter school directors from the County. VCOE also conducts a variety of trainings, including trainings for Brown Act compliance for board members and charter school staff. Furthermore, VCOE is always and readily available for any questions and guidance county charter schools need. R-04: Disagree The VCOE already has the Charter School Oversight Director attend each monthly board meeting and conduct annual site inspections as well as programmatic reports. We believe that this is consistent and sufficient oversight. R-05: Disagree See above. We also have a very solid MOU in place with the VCOE in addition to our petition. .
